This project explores higher symmetries in representation theory, aiming to extend existing methods to general linear groups of larger ranks. It also investigates affine Hecke algebras to understand their homological structures, contributing to the field of algebraic geometry.
The subject of representation theory originally arose from the study of symmetries on certain spaces.
It has long been known that many two-dimensional geometric phenomena have algebraic explanations via the subject of representation theory.
In the last fifteen years it has been conjectured that analogous explanations for problems ins three-dimensional geometry should raise from introducing so-called higher symmetries, giving rise to the subject of 2-representation theory, or categorification.
